TPS22946: Ultra Librarian Footprint vs. Datasheet Footprint

Part Number: TPS22946

Hello, 

I have a question about the footprint for the TPS22946 load switch presented in the datasheet versus the one available in the Ultra Librarian site.

In the datasheet of the TPS22946, the recommended pad diameter is 0.225 mm, but in the Ultra Librarian footprint it is 0.305mm.

What pad size should be used and would you need to add solder mask expansion?

Or is the footprint in Ultra Librarian ok to be used as-is?
